Transaction d68b019595f2120723c652ec58ec368e944e426e92d92c2a401cde4faa6428bf
1 Input
1 Output
-
d68b019595f2120723c652ec58ec368e944e426e92d92c2a401cde4faa6428bf:0
- value
- 22158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ec633b13b384759817a45d775a7cb7b154403a OP_EQUAL
- address
- 384jjHBehEZHPh1wE4YmLtK3u8zXvrEpmq